Job Description - Assistant Nurse Manager Cath Lab

As Mount Sinai grows, so does our legacy in high-quality health care.

Since 1949, Mount Sinai Medical Center has remained committed to providing access to its diverse community. In delivering an unmatched level of clinical expertise, our medical center is committed to recruiting and training top healthcare workers from across the country. We offer the latest in advanced medicine, technology, and comfort in 12 facilities across Miami-Dade (including our 674-bed main campus facility) and Monroe Counties, with 38 medical services, including cancer care, 24/7 emergency care, orthopedics, cardiovascular care, and more. Mount Sinai takes pride in being South Florida's largest private independent not-for-profit hospital, dedicated to continuing the training of the next generation of medical pioneers.

Position Responsibilities

  • Provides support and supervision of the procedural staff to ensure patient load time of 0730 and turnaround time of 30 minutes or less.
  • Assists Nurse Manager in organizing and directing activities of the assigned unit as indicated by the Nurse Director.
  • Reports back to Nurse Manager status of all procedural colleagues whether they are developing in their role appropriately so that evaluations can be completed accurately on a probationary and annual basis.
  • Supervises and establishes new guidelines for the utilization of supplies in procedural spaces to prevent waste.
  • Provides education to all staff to ensure that all colleagues remain current with best practice and competencies.
  • Interprets the philosophy, goals, objectives, policies and procedures of the department to all employees, patients and families.
  • Staff management to include recruitment, retention, coaching, training, evaluation and development, as well as preparation and delegation of work schedules and workflow. This also includes assigning of preceptor.
  • Demonstrates good judgment and knowledge of department needs in classifying and maintaining data.
  • Responsible for the unit/s in the absence of the Nurse Manager.
  • Responsible for projects/processes that are essential to the success of the unit. (Charging processes, new hire orientation, maintain statistical data, time/attendance and QI).
  • Ensure vendor compliance with medical center and departmental policies.
  • Actively participates and manages operations during emergency situations, including participation in disaster preparedness.
  • Completes monthly schedules to ensure adequate staffing based on patient care, acuity, and workforce targets.
  • Reviews, and approves time cards and makes timely edits in Kronos. Manages staffing on a regular basis.
  • Assists the Nurse Manager & Director in ensuring compliance with established HRS/JCAHO requirements.
  • Supports the ongoing improvement of quality and performance metrics for nursing including, but not limited to core measures, hospital acquired infections, safety initiatives and the patient experience.
  • Disseminates pertinent departmental information to staff as indicated.
  • Organizes and presents 3 monthly staff meetings per calendar year. Holds a morning departmental huddle once per week.
  • Meets with Nurse Manager daily to discuss pertinent information in the department so that it can be addressed appropriately. Meets with Nursing Director twice a week to discuss objectives for the department and the progress made towards those goals.
  • Participates in weekend huddle call as assigned.
  • Serves as a professional role model, coach, and resource for employees. Participates actively in Nursing and/or hospital committees and work groups and assists in the development and implementation of the units shared governance model.
  • Performs other related duties as assigned.

Qualifications

  • License/Registration/Certification

    • Licensure as a Registered Nurse in the State of Florida is required. BLS and ACLS required (ACLS not required for CCC).
  • Education

    • Graduate from an accredited school of nursing, BSN preferred.
  • Experience

    • Three years of Nursing leadership experience.
